Then, who Popularised worship of vithoba?
Namdev (c.1270–1350), a Shudra tailor, wrote short Marathi devotional poems in praise of Vithoba called abhangas (literally 'unbroken'), and used the call-and-response kirtan (literally 'repeating') form of singing to praise the glory of his Lord.

Similarly, it is asked, who is vithoba God?
Vithoba, also known as Vi(t)thal(a) and Panduranga, is a Hindu deity predominantly worshipped in the Indian state of Maharashtra. He is generally considered as a manifestation of the god Vishnu or his avatar, Krishna.

Why does vithoba stand on brick?
Pundalik was very pleased to see that God himself had come to meet him. He offered a brick known as veet in Marathi as an asana to the divine guest to sit. To this date the brick forms the asana of the God. And thus there he is, the Vitthal or Vishnu or Krishna, still standing on the brick Pundalik had offered him!
